Be patient Mike! It takes more than a couple of treatments to clear the CLL out of the bone marrow so that it can produce adequate amounts of blood cells. Also don't forget that treatment also suppress the bone marrow's production capability.
Hopefully you'll get some feedback from BR (and FCR patients, who would see similar responses) regarding how many treatments they went through before they saw an improvement in their counts to higher than their pre-treatment counts.
